How much do telephone customer service j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 17, 2026, the average hourly pay for telephone customer service in Baton Rouge, LA is $18.05,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.76 and $20.10 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a telephone customer service representative?

Telephone customer service representatives are professionals who assist customers over the phone by answering questions, resolving issues, processing orders, and providing information about products or services. They are the first point of contact for many businesses and play a key role in ensuring customer satisfaction. These representatives use communication and problem-solving skills to address customer needs efficiently and maintain a positive company image. They may work in call centers or remotely, handling a variety of inquiries and concerns.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a telephone customer service representative?

To thrive as a Telephone Customer Service Representative, you need strong communication skills, problem-solving abilities,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) software and telephone systems is essential. Patience, active listening, and a calm demeanor are standout soft skills for handling diverse customer interactions. These skills ensure efficient issue resolution, customer satisfaction, and a positive company image.

What are some common challenges faced by telephone customer service representatives, and how can they be managed effectively?

Telephone Customer Service representatives often encounter challenges such as handling difficult or upset customers, managing high call volumes, and resolving complex issues quickly. To manage these challenges, it's important to develop strong communication and active listening skills, remain patient and empathetic, and utilize any scripts or knowledge bases provided by the company. Support from supervisors and collaboration with team members can also help in sharing solutions and best practices, making the work environment more supportive and efficient.

What is the difference between Telephone Customer Service vs Call Center Representative?

AspectTelephone Customer ServiceCall Center Representative
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; customer service skillsHigh school diploma or equivalent; customer service skills
Work EnvironmentOffice or remote; direct customer interaction via phoneCall centers; high-volume inbound/outbound calls
Industry UsageRetail, telecom, banking, healthcareTelecom, tech support, sales, customer support
Search & Comparison IntentCustomer service roles involving phone supportCall center jobs focusing on high call volume

While both roles involve phone-based customer interactions, Telephone Customer Service emphasizes personalized support and problem-solving, often in a one-on-one setting. Call Center Representatives typically handle high call volumes, focusing on efficiency and standardized responses. Both roles require similar skills and credentials but differ mainly in work environment and scope of interaction.
